TKN Technical Report Series

Dynamic Adaptive Wake-up Scheduling Scheme for Supporting Periodic Traffic in WSNs
Author Khader, Osama and Willig, Andreas
Year 2008
Number TKN-08-012
Month November
Institution Telecommunication Networks Group, Technical University Berlin
Abstract In many applications in wireless sensor network source nodes generate and send periodic tra±c to the sink through a number of intermediate nodes (or forwarders). In such network forwarders have forwarding duties but want at the same time to spend as much time as possible in an energy-saving deep-sleep mode. In this work we explore the periodicity of tra±c so that the forwarders wake up at just the right time to catch an incoming packet, forward it and go quickly back to sleep mode. A key assumption for this work is that the forwarders do not know the tra±c period beforehand, but they have to estimate the period and maintain their estimate over time. A key di±culty is that the period estimation and the scheduling of wakeup times will have to deal with jitter in the packet inter-arrival times. If a packet arrives before the forwarder wakes up, it is lost. This opens up a tradeo® between loss rates and the sleeping activities of the forwarder: when the forwarder wakes up early, the packet loss rate will be low but the forwarder spends more energy, and vice versa. The main contributions of this report are the following ones: (i) we design and implement local estimators for tra±c period and jitter; (ii) we design and implement a scheduling scheme by which a forwarder locally decides when to sleep and when to wake up; and (iii) we adjoin mechanisms to this scheme that allow to update the period and jitter estimates and to react to changes in the locally observed loss rate. We use measurements and simulation experiments to evaluate our proposed algorithms.
